Modeling of LSF Technology in Building Design & Construction Case-study: Parand Residential Complex, Iran

The adopted strategy to overcome the housing shortage crisis in Iran is the mass production.The way forward to accelerate the mass production, is adopting the industrial building systems with the increased prefabrication.One of the most optimal new building systems is Lightweight Steel Framing (LSF) Technology.Parand Residential Complex as the first serious project to industrialize the construction processes in Iran is facing the various problems during the processes of manufacture and execution of LSF components. The research aim is to offer an optimized model for manufacturing and execution processes of LSF Technology in the constructive projects which in it the deficiencies are compensated and strengths are intensified.So, case-studies and combined strategies has adopted as research method and based on it, the manufacture and execution processes of LSF technology in the case-study, were taken into consideration to recognize the existing advantages and disadvantages. The results of the research show that disadvantages of the manufacture and execution processes can be improved into one combined model.Finally, with offering four strategies to compensate the deficiencies and three strategies to intensify the strengths, the paper develops a model to coordinate the processes of manufacturing and execution in LSF technology in building design and construction.
